About this game:
+Time crystals gained offline can be used to do time warps, granting the same amount of time offline, so you don't lose a single second if you are offline. It doesn't push players to log back every morning.
+Graphics are nice. In the end game, you don't stare at some numbers you can't even imagine.
+The progress is not that slow. It doesn't take 2 years to complete the game (getting all talents).
+The gift boxes give surprises to players. Unlike some games, this system really rewards the players nicely in a good way.
+Easy to understand, with different possible builds.
And...
-It lags. Especially in the late game with no further optimizations available.
-Poorly balanced. At least before the update. Haven't tested it out because...
-When you have completed the game and come back, you are at square one again.
-Finally, you will only progress slower with all those updates.
